The goal of this study is to create a LKPD based on CTL that is valid, practical and effective. This study employed the research and development (R&D) technique.. The characteristics of LKPD based CTL are that it is real (concrete), clarifies a problem, is easy to use, has special characteristics. LKPD based on CTL was validated by 5 experts, 5 expert validators, namely material experts, language experts, media experts, and teacher experts in the field of mathematics at SMP Negeri 14 Merangin. Product validity can be determined from the results of the validation sheet. The results of student interviews and questionnaire responses can be used to assess how useful the product is. Learning outcomes and learning activities can be used to determine effectiveness.The average validation results by material experts was 4.36 in the very valid category, validation results by language experts were 4.70 in the very valid category, validation results by media experts were 4.00 in the very valid category, and validation results by teachers mathematics was 4.60 and the overall validation results were 4.42 in the very valid category. Product practicality obtained a percentage of 77.64% in the practical category. Product effectiveness, in terms of student learning outcomes, obtained a completion percentage of 77.27% in the effective category. Meanwhile, for learning activities, students obtained a percentage of 84.44% in the very active category. The results of research and development show that the CTL-based LKPD created is valid, useful and efficient.
